What is a “Change in Status Event” or “Qualifying Event?
In general, a Change in Status Event or Qualifying Event refers to a life-changing event that may affect your eligibility or need to participate in your company’s cafeteria plan. These events may include, but are not limited to: births, deaths, adoptions, marriage, divorce, change in employment status of yourself or your spouse, judicial decrees, judgements or orders, changes in cost of a benefit, changes in coverage offered, loss of eligibiltiy of a dependent, etc.
